Here is a stereo track: You can make separate left-channel and right-channel tracks so that you can edit them separately. Open the Audio Track Dropdown Menu and choose Split Stereo Track : Now you can see the two tracks marked "Left" and "Right": Note carefully that after this split the Left channel is panned hard left ...

I've been blown away by … WebThe new Fairlight Audio Core and FlexBus handle all audio processing in DaVinci Resolve, allowing you to work with more tracks and realtime effects plug‑ins than ever before. The number of tracks, buses, plug‑ins and latency compensation is based on the available processing power and memory in your computer.
